More Costa Rica Photos

In an earlier post, I included photos from the area around Junquillal. After leaving Junquillal, I visited the fishing/diving village of Playas del Coco, which is about 20km from the Liberia airport.


Coco attracts tourists from Costa Rica and abroad who are into waterports--fishing, boating and diving--by day and who want lots of night life. There are several nice hotels and very good restaurants. I enjoyed my time there, but....I tend to like the peace, quiet and unspoiled nature of less developed areas further down the Pacific coast.
